## Alert: Mapnest address widget timing out

Heads up — the Mapnest autocomplete widget is throwing timeouts on roughly one in five keystrokes, which users definitely notice. Usually it's the suggestion cache going cold after a deploy; a cache warm-up normally fixes it in minutes. If it's still flapping after that, hold the release and ping the widget crew at the address below.

escalation mailbox, bafog-fafog: ulador@paliqlabs.internal

Parity status between the Brindle SDK for Kotlin and the Swift client is close enough to ship: streaming uploads, retry policy, and offline cache all match. Remaining gap is pagination prefetch, which Kotlin handles server-side. For the Maplewick release train, both SDKs will share one config surface so docs stay consistent. Load testing showed the shared defaults hold at projected Q3 traffic. The aligned tuning constants both SDKs will ship with are listed below.

constants for bawif-kawif:
QUOTAS = {
    "ulaael": 5,
    "holael": 10,
}

### Account Recovery — Catalogue Import (Lintwood)

Quick one for review: when the Lintwood catalogue import wipes a patron's session table, the recovery flow re-seeds accounts from the nightly snapshot. Check that the importer skips locked accounts — last time it didn't. To rerun recovery against staging you'll need the vault passphrase, which is appended just below.

recovery phrase for yafof-tajof: julmir-kelax-julvan-holath-belvan-holir-ralael-ralvan-ralath-julvan-silmir-istmir-kaswyn-ulamir

## Canary Gating — Vexhall Deploy Pipeline

Canary promotion for the Vexhall ingest service is gated on three automated checks: error-rate delta under 0.5% against baseline, p99 latency within 10% of the control cohort, and zero new authentication failures over a 15-minute window. Manual override requires sign-off from the release captain and is logged to the audit channel. Rollback is automatic if any gate fails twice consecutively. The gate thresholds and cohort sizing are defined in the following configuration values.

deployment values, yahag-tawef:
ZORWYN_HOST=zorwyn.tolvaqlabs.internal
ZORWYN_PORT=9300